Arsenal boss Unai Emery believes Mesut Ozil's decision to retire from international duty with Germany will help his club form, as quoted by The Telegraph. What's the word? Unfairly made the poster boy for Germany's failings at the World Cup in Russia, Mesut Ozil quit the international scene in pre-season with a statement that accused German football of internal racism and sparked a fierce debate. The 30-year-old has continued to face regular backlash from his home nation in the months that have followed, with Germany struggling to find form in their fixtures in recent months, but has earned the backing of Arsenal manager Emery.
